The following list presents the potential protein homologs for MtnD using FASTA alignment tool. For all top hits, a bidirectional analysis was performed and those showing the same pair of proteins are considered to be potential orthologs.
The column Best hit bidirectional informs if MtnD was found to be best hit in the alignment with the protein of the respective organism.
